
在数据挖掘领域,重要的工作技能包括编程能力、统计分析、机器学习、数据处理与清洗、数据可视化、问题解决能力、沟通能力。其中,编程能力是数据挖掘工作中最基础且重要的一项技能。数据挖掘涉及大量的数据处理与分析,熟练掌握编程语言如Python、R可以极大提高工作效率。Python由于其强大的库和广泛的应用,成为数据科学领域的首选语言。通过编程,数据科学家能够自动化重复的任务、实现复杂的算法、开发自定义解决方案,这些都大大增强了数据挖掘的效率与效果。
一、编程能力
在数据挖掘中,编程能力无疑是最重要的技能之一。Python和R是数据科学家最常用的两种编程语言。Python凭借其丰富的库如NumPy、Pandas、Scikit-learn和TensorFlow,成为数据科学领域的首选语言。R则在统计分析和数据可视化方面表现出色。数据科学家需要熟练掌握这些编程语言,以便进行数据处理、清洗、分析和建模。此外,熟悉SQL也是必要的,因为许多数据存储在关系数据库中,通过SQL可以高效地查询和操作这些数据。
二、统计分析
统计分析是数据挖掘工作的基础,能够帮助数据科学家理解数据的分布和特性。掌握统计学的基本概念,如均值、方差、标准差、回归分析和假设检验等,对于数据挖掘至关重要。这些统计方法可以帮助数据科学家从数据中提取有价值的信息,发现数据中的模式和趋势。例如,回归分析可以用于预测连续变量,而分类分析可以用于预测类别变量。统计分析还可以帮助识别异常值和噪声,提高数据挖掘模型的准确性和可靠性。
三、机器学习
机器学习是数据挖掘的核心技术之一,能够自动从数据中学习并进行预测和分类。掌握各种机器学习算法,如线性回归、逻辑回归、决策树、随机森林、支持向量机和神经网络等,是数据科学家的基本功。数据科学家需要了解这些算法的基本原理、适用场景和优缺点,能够根据具体问题选择合适的算法。此外,数据科学家还需要掌握机器学习模型的评估方法,如交叉验证、混淆矩阵和ROC曲线等,以确保模型的性能和稳定性。
四、数据处理与清洗
在数据挖掘中,数据处理与清洗是必不可少的一步。原始数据往往存在缺失值、噪声和异常值,需要通过数据清洗进行处理。数据处理包括数据格式转换、数据归一化和特征工程等步骤,以便为后续的分析和建模做好准备。数据科学家需要熟练掌握各种数据处理和清洗的方法和工具,如Pandas、NumPy和Scikit-learn等,以提高数据质量和模型的准确性。数据清洗是一个耗时且繁琐的过程,但它是数据挖掘成功的关键。
五、数据可视化
数据可视化是数据挖掘的重要组成部分,通过图形化的方式展示数据和分析结果,可以帮助数据科学家和决策者更直观地理解数据。掌握各种数据可视化工具和技术,如Matplotlib、Seaborn和Tableau等,是数据科学家的基本技能。数据可视化不仅可以用于探索性数据分析,发现数据中的模式和趋势,还可以用于展示分析结果,支持业务决策。例如,柱状图、折线图和散点图可以用于展示数据的分布和关系,而热力图和网络图可以用于展示数据的复杂关系和结构。
六、问题解决能力
数据挖掘工作中经常会遇到各种问题和挑战,如数据缺失、数据噪声、模型过拟合和计算资源不足等。数据科学家需要具备良好的问题解决能力,能够分析问题的原因,找到合适的解决方案。例如,对于数据缺失问题,可以采用插值法、均值填充法或删除法进行处理;对于模型过拟合问题,可以采用正则化、交叉验证或增加训练数据等方法进行处理。问题解决能力不仅需要扎实的技术基础,还需要灵活的思维和创新的解决方案。
七、沟通能力
数据科学家不仅需要具备强大的技术能力,还需要具备良好的沟通能力。数据挖掘的结果需要向业务决策者和团队成员进行汇报和解释,清晰地传达数据分析的结论和建议。数据科学家需要能够用简单明了的语言解释复杂的技术概念和分析结果,能够与业务团队有效沟通,理解业务需求和问题。良好的沟通能力可以帮助数据科学家更好地理解业务问题,提供更有价值的分析和建议,促进团队合作和项目成功。
八、项目管理能力
数据挖掘项目往往涉及多个阶段和多个团队的协作,数据科学家需要具备良好的项目管理能力,能够有效地规划、组织和协调项目的各个环节。项目管理能力包括制定项目计划、分配任务、监控进度、管理风险和沟通协调等。数据科学家需要能够合理安排时间和资源,确保项目按时按质完成。项目管理能力还包括团队管理和领导能力,能够激励和指导团队成员,共同完成项目目标。
九、持续学习能力
数据科学领域发展迅速,新技术和新方法层出不穷,数据科学家需要具备持续学习的能力,能够不断更新自己的知识和技能。持续学习能力包括自我学习、参加培训和研讨会、阅读专业文献和参与社区交流等。数据科学家需要保持对新技术和新方法的敏感性,不断学习和应用最新的技术和工具,以提高自己的专业水平和竞争力。持续学习能力不仅可以帮助数据科学家跟上技术发展的步伐,还可以激发创新思维,提供更优的解决方案。
十、行业知识
数据科学家需要具备一定的行业知识,能够理解和分析业务问题,提供有针对性的解决方案。行业知识包括了解行业的背景、发展趋势、业务流程和关键指标等。行业知识可以帮助数据科学家更好地理解数据和问题,提出更有价值的分析和建议。数据科学家可以通过与业务团队的交流和合作,深入了解行业和业务需求,不断积累行业知识,提高自己的分析能力和业务价值。
十一、工具使用能力
数据挖掘工作中会使用到各种工具和软件,如数据处理工具、分析工具、可视化工具和机器学习平台等。数据科学家需要熟练掌握这些工具的使用,以提高工作效率和分析效果。常用的数据处理和分析工具包括Pandas、NumPy、Scikit-learn、TensorFlow和Keras等;常用的数据可视化工具包括Matplotlib、Seaborn和Tableau等;常用的机器学习平台包括SageMaker、Azure ML和Google Cloud ML等。熟练使用这些工具可以帮助数据科学家更高效地完成数据处理、分析和建模任务。
十二、伦理和隐私意识
在数据挖掘工作中,数据科学家需要具备良好的伦理和隐私意识,遵守数据保护法规和行业标准,保护用户隐私和数据安全。伦理和隐私意识包括了解和遵守GDPR、CCPA等数据保护法规,确保数据的合法获取和使用,保护用户的隐私和权益。数据科学家需要在数据处理和分析过程中,采取必要的技术和管理措施,确保数据的安全和隐私保护,避免数据泄露和滥用。伦理和隐私意识不仅是数据科学家的职业操守,也是保护用户权益和维护行业信誉的重要保障。
在数据挖掘工作中,具备上述技能和能力,可以帮助数据科学家更好地完成数据处理、分析和建模任务,提供有价值的分析和建议,支持业务决策和创新。数据科学家需要不断学习和更新自己的知识和技能,保持对新技术和新方法的敏感性,提高自己的专业水平和竞争力。通过不断实践和积累经验,数据科学家可以提升自己的分析能力和业务价值,成为数据挖掘领域的专家和领导者。
相关问答FAQs:
数据挖掘工作技能包括哪些关键要素?
在数据挖掘领域,具备一系列关键技能是非常重要的。这些技能不仅包括技术能力,还涵盖了分析思维和业务理解。首先,数据挖掘人员需要掌握统计学和数学基础,以便于理解数据模式和趋势。熟练使用数据分析工具,如Python、R、SQL等编程语言,也至关重要。这些工具可以帮助分析和处理大规模数据集。此外,掌握机器学习算法和数据建模技术是提升数据挖掘技能的关键因素。
除了技术能力,数据挖掘还需要良好的问题解决能力和批判性思维。面对复杂的数据集,能够提出有效的问题、识别出数据中的潜在问题,并制定相应的解决方案是非常重要的。此外,了解业务背景和行业知识能帮助数据挖掘人员更好地理解数据的实际应用场景,从而提升分析的准确性和有效性。
最后,沟通能力在数据挖掘工作中同样不可或缺。数据挖掘人员需要能够清晰地呈现分析结果,与不同团队成员交流,确保数据驱动的决策能够被有效地实施。
如何提升数据挖掘的实用技能?
提升数据挖掘的实用技能可以通过多种途径进行。首先,参加专业培训课程和在线学习平台可以帮助深入理解数据挖掘的基础知识和最新趋势。这些课程通常涵盖数据预处理、特征工程、模型选择和评估等内容,提供了系统的学习框架。
其次,实践经验是提升技能的重要途径。参与实际项目或比赛,如Kaggle比赛,不仅可以应用所学知识,还能提升解决实际问题的能力。通过处理真实数据和面对实际挑战,能够加深对数据挖掘流程的理解,积累宝贵的项目经验。
此外,持续关注行业动态和新技术也非常关键。数据挖掘领域发展迅速,新的算法和工具层出不穷。通过阅读相关文献、参与行业会议和研讨会,能够保持对行业前沿的敏感度,及时更新自己的知识体系。
最后,建立一个良好的网络,与其他数据科学家、分析师和行业专家交流,可以获得不同的视角和经验分享。这种交流不仅有助于技能提升,还能开拓视野,为职业发展提供更多机会。
数据挖掘在职业发展中的重要性是什么?
数据挖掘在职业发展中扮演着越来越重要的角色。随着各行各业对数据驱动决策的依赖程度加深,数据挖掘技能成为求职者的重要竞争优势。无论是在金融、医疗、零售还是制造业,能够有效处理和分析数据的人才都备受青睐。
数据挖掘能力可以帮助个人在职业生涯中实现多种发展路径。例如,数据分析师、数据科学家、机器学习工程师等职位都要求具备扎实的数据挖掘技能。通过不断提升这些技能,个人能够在职业晋升中脱颖而出,获得更高层次的职位。
此外,数据挖掘不仅限于技术层面,其跨学科性质也为职业发展提供了更多可能性。具备数据挖掘技能的专业人士,能够在商业分析、市场研究、运营优化等多个领域找到合适的岗位。在这些领域中,数据挖掘能力能够帮助企业制定更为精准的策略,提升竞争力。
在未来,随着人工智能和大数据技术的不断演进,数据挖掘的应用场景将更加广泛。因此,提升数据挖掘技能不仅有助于当前的职业发展,更为未来的职业生涯铺平道路。掌握这一技能将使专业人士在职场中保持领先优势,适应快速变化的市场需求。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。



